What is quantitative reasoning in logic?

Quantitative Logic Reasoning aims at providing a unified treatment to several tasks that involve both a deductive logic reasoning and some form of inference about quantities. Typically, reasoning with quantities involves probabilities and/or cardinality assessments.O
